Album Notes

Brian Saint & the Sinners featuring Brian Saint on lead vocals & guitar, Colie on lead guitar & backing vox, Rob Shuman on bass, and Sara Tomeck on drums. The group was featured prominently in the local NJ media for their new Asbury "Park Rock" sound and performed in the fabled musical city by the sea relentlessly throughout the year 2000. Subsequently Brian went on to form Agency, Colie moved to Hollywood and started AERIA Records, Sara joined Days Awake, Rob took an audio engineering position with Sony, Jon Sara has played cello on a gazillion albums, and Ben Bleefield continues to narrowly evade criminal prosecution for a variety of evils..

Asbury's "Park Rock" Chapter..
author: Colie Brice
These were fun times. I met Brian Saint at the Daily Grind coffee shop in Ocean Grove, NJ. the Tri City News had just done a huge write upon him and he was hosting an open mic at the Moon Rock in Asbury Park which he invited me to attend. I showed up one night, did my set and then Brian asked me to jam along to his tunes.. A weekor so later Brian shows up at open mic with Rob Shuman on bass, I bring a long an old friend named Ben Bleefield, who knew this cute teen age chick named Sara Tomek who could play like John Bonham :) Donny G, Bear, and Chris Barry were all Moon Rock regulars who endured listening as our Thursday night jams were sculpted into tunes in front of a live following of Asbury Park bohemians, artists, surfers, etc. It was a happening scene.. This live recording is a sonic snapshot of that era as Tillie looked down upon our shoulders.. Life moved on, but these were special, magical nights for all involved..
